    Dell Vostro Desktop Line Gets a Makeover

    Dell today announced its redesigned Vostro desktop line for small businesses, with enhancements such as increased storage and expandability based on ongoing customer feedback. Starting at $319, the Vostro 220, 220s and 420 are available today in North America, tomorrow in most of South America, followed by Asia Pacific and Japan Oct. 20, Europe, Middle East and Africa Nov.3 and Brazil Nov. 11.     Dell continues to enhance its Vostro portfolio to address the top technology issues facing small-business customers including easy-to-use and maintain computer systems, data storage, and quality service and support, all at a price small businesses can afford.

    Building on a strong recommendation rate of 98 percent from current Vostro customers, new Vostro desktops deliver more of what customers demand in a small-business PC and address many of their top pain points. Key improvements include:
    • Refined industrial design with a glossy front;
    • Greater convenience through redesigned optical drive bays;
    • Increased internal storage capacity with one terabyte hard drives offering up to 4 terabytes of internal storage in the Vostro 420;
    • Standard 10/100/1000 Gigabit Ethernet across full line for fast network access; and
    • The Vostro 420 high-performance system also offers dual display capability, and more expandability and flexibility with 10 total USB ports and seven total PCI/PCIe expansion slots for more network, sound or graphics cards.
    New customer-driven features have also been added, including:
    • The latest in Intel technology and performance with the Intel G45 Express chipset;
    • Optional Blu-Ray Disk drives for data storage and video playback;
    • PS/2 and serial ports to enable use of older devices; and
    • The Vostro 420 offers an eSATA connector to transfer data to an external storage device faster than with USB.

    Windows 10: In the new version of Windows, Explorer has a section called Quick Access. This includes your frequent folders and recent files. Explorer defaults to opening this page when you open a new window. If you’d rather open the usual This PC, with links to your drives and library folders, follow these steps:

    • Open a new Explorer window.
    • Click View in the ribbon.
    • Click Options.
    • Under General, next to “Open File Explorer to:” choose “This PC.”
    • Click OK
